[edit] Overview

Chaoyang is a district of northeastern Beijing, China.

Chaoyang is home to the majority of Beijing's many foreign embassies, the well-known Sanlitun bar street, as well as Beijing's growing CBD. The Olympic Park, built for the 2008 Summer Olympics, is also in Chaoyang, as is Beijing Capital International Airport.

Chaoyang extends west to Chaoyangmen on the eastern 2nd Ring Road, and extending nearly as far east as the Ximazhuang toll station on the Jingtong Expressway. Within the urban area of Beijing it occupies 475 square kilometers, making it the largest district with (Haidian coming in second. Chaoyang has a population of 2,289,796 (2000 Census), making it the second most populous in Beijing.

Chaoyang is also home to Silk Street, and many other market areas, shopping malls, and restaurant strips.
